Over de organisatie
Imaging is a crucial element of all stages of medical care: from screening, diagnosis, prognosis and treatment, to the monitoring of therapy. With the increasing size and complexity of images, automated image analysis is an indispensible support for clinicians. Moreover, it opens novel ways to improve care.
We contribute to this rapidly growing field by developing new concepts for medical image analysis as well as applications that support clinicians in their decision making, ultimately aiming for safer and better care.
Our group investigates image analysis on methodological topics as registration, quantification, crowdsourcing and machine learning. In close contact with industry and hospitals, we contribute to the field of image analysis for oncology, cardiology, neurology and histopathology as well as the field of high-field MRI acquisition and RF safety.
We provide courses on the topic of Medical Image Analysis in both the Bachelor's and the Master's curriculum (both BME and ME programs). In cooperation with the University Medical Center Utrecht we offer a joint master in Medical Imaging.
